Notacon 9 (2012) Videos (Hacking Illustrated Series InfoSec Tutorial Videos)

Notacon 9 (2012) Videos

These are the videos from the 9th Notacon conference held April 12th-15th, 2012. Not all of them are security related, but  I hope my viewers will enjoy them anyway. Thanks to Froggy and Tyger for having me up, and to the video team: SatNights, Widget, Securi-D, Purge, Bunsen, Fry Steve and myself. Sorry about the sound issues, but there is only so much pain I want to go through in post. Also for some videos we only have the slides or the live video, but not both.
